Hi Brian,
I am not an attorney and my comments here must not be construed as legal advice. I suggest you respond along these lines: "I would like to cooperate and conclude this matter, but I cannot sign the Consent Order as written because it contains factual errors. For the period of 03/11/2022 - 3/10/2024, I provided you with certificates documenting the required 28 hours of approved continuing education. All requirements for that period were met." You should never attest to false information. There is high potential for confusion in this matter, so be careful to state everything in clear, direct, short statements.
